    DIY Clearsight equivalent?

    Has anyone done a DIY/aftermarket 'clearsight' equivalent on a Discovery 4?

    It strikes me as a genuine safety plus, and I've used the equivalent in some work vans. When loaded for camping etc, the rearview centre mirror is useless, and I would love to do this.

    JB Hi Fi lists some 'rearview mirror cameras'. Rear View Mirror Monitors - Car Camera Kits At JB Hi-Fi

    But they seem to be focused on actual reversing - anyone know if they can be rigged to be switched on/turned off to run 'permanently' when driving normally?

    The other issue will be camera mounting. Either tailgate, or up at the back somehow...

    Thoughts?
